puzzled

word · lemma: puzzle

Definition

Feeling confused because you do not understand something, or something doesn’t make sense.

Usage & Nuances

'Puzzled' is informal to neutral and often describes a mild or brief confusion. Common collocations: 'look puzzled', 'seem puzzled', 'puzzled expression'. 'Puzzled' is less intense than 'bewildered' or 'perplexed'.
